thirty-three million, nine hundred ninety-eight thousand, eight hundred eighty-one
Currency £33998881 in british english: thirty-three million, nine hundred ninety-eight thousand, eight hundred eighty-one Pound.
In Price: 33998881.00
32998881 | 34998881